Transaction 12c39620246260a18ecc61fcaa38532d3eff1770de080b84cd862d12bd34da46

1 Input
2 Outputs
  • 12c39620246260a18ecc61fcaa38532d3eff1770de080b84cd862d12bd34da46:0
  • value  106431
    address  3FBQvBkPkUXHHh2vqEVEwyRKRHNK33wg1A
  • 12c39620246260a18ecc61fcaa38532d3eff1770de080b84cd862d12bd34da46:1
  • value  506895
    address  17tSsdCU815p8rSNA8KoPsRkAX8hNFWMTz